Why Live in Union City

Union City, CA, is a growing East Bay suburb that emerged from the merger of Alvarado and Decoto in 1959. Over the decades, its population has surged to over 70,000, transforming farmland into a bustling community with scenic views of the East Bay Hills and San Francisco Bay. The city boasts 30 parks covering 136 acres, including Charles F. Kennedy Park and Old Alvarado Park, which host events like the Union City Arts and Wine Festival and Culture Fest. The East Bay Regional Park District offers extensive trails through Garin and Dry Creek Pioneer Regional Parks. Union City’s downtown area, now known as the Station District, features the Union City Intermodal Transit Station and Union Square Marketplace, providing high-density housing, job centers, and diverse dining options. Union Landing, located off Interstate 880, is a major shopping hub with over 70 retailers and restaurants. The New Haven Unified School District serves the area with highly rated schools offering dual language immersion and STEM programs. Union City’s housing market includes midcentury and contemporary single-family homes, townhouses, and 1980s condominiums, with rising property values reflecting high demand. Healthcare services are robust, with Kaiser Permanente and other clinics providing extensive care options. Transportation is facilitated by AC Transit, Union City Transit, and BART, connecting residents to San Francisco and San Jose. The Mediterranean climate ensures mild winters and dry summers, although the area faces risks from earthquakes and wildfires.
